Output 84b92a661a7431a693ebd1a3e49dd44f8c2a28b0a2c7cf94de2eccaa99ef82af:0

value
522760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8131000ca63ffcb5c046c042afa21ffd3d6916bb OP_EQUAL
address
3DU7ntAahem3mx29sxZh1jd2njwuYz5eCP
transaction
84b92a661a7431a693ebd1a3e49dd44f8c2a28b0a2c7cf94de2eccaa99ef82af
spent
true